Floyd fights with his brain as well as his fists. It's one of the things that sets him apart from his competition. He can fight with aggression or can be elusive and defensive depending on his opponent.

What you see as inconsistent is actually his greatest strength--the ability to adapt to his opponent's style and stifle his opponent's efforts.

It's what makes him MORE consistent than his contemporaries. They can only win or lose with one style, while Floyd just wins with whichever style he needs to do so.
